The garage occupancy feed for the Brindlewood campus arrives over a message queue every thirty seconds, one record per level, published by the Stallgrid edge boxes. Counts can briefly go negative when a sensor double-fires on exit; the ingest job clamps these to zero and flags the interval. If the feed stalls for more than five minutes, the dashboard falls back to the last known snapshot. Sensor mappings, queue names, and the replay procedure are documented on the internal page below.

runbook for tahog-kadug: https://gitlab.qirvanworks.corp/projects/pages/view/b139298aed28

Runbook note for the eng sync: Quillgate webhook delivery retries failed posts five times with exponential backoff, starting at thirty seconds and capping at one hour. After exhaustion, events land in the dead-letter queue and require manual replay. Receivers returning 4xx are not retried; only 5xx and timeouts are. The replay procedure and current backoff configuration are documented on the internal page below.

runbook for hawif-tajeg: https://grafana.plorvasoft.example/dash

Facilities Ticket — Cleaning Crew Access, Brindle Annex

For new starters handling evening lock-up: the Sorano Cleaning crew arrives nightly at 21:30 via the annex side door. Check their rota sheet, note arrival in the log, and ensure the storeroom is relocked afterward. To let them through the side door, enter the access code below.

badge for yaweg-hafog: bdg-GX-6